Free Your EEG: Wireless and Wearable Systems for the Lab and Beyond

Free Your EEG: Wireless and Wearable Systems for the Lab and Beyond

The evolution of wearable technology for recording physiological signals represents a transformative leap for research, particularly when it comes to electroencephalography (EEG). These advancements allow researchers to capture brain activity data in real-world settings, moving beyond the confines of laboratory-based experiments. Mobile and wearable EEG devices utilize wireless technology to transmit data, offering significant advantages over traditional methods.
